Blockchain for Land Records: Transparency in Property Ownership

The Problem with Traditional Land Registries

Land records are often paper-based, vulnerable to loss, manipulation, and corruption. In many countries, disputes over ownership clog courts, while fraudulent sales erode public trust.

By deploying land records on blockchain, governments can create transparent, tamper-proof systems for property registration.

Advantages of Blockchain-Based Land Registries

  • Immutability – Once a land record is stored, it cannot be altered.
  • Transparency – Ownership history is visible to all authorized stakeholders.
  • Fraud Prevention – Reduces double sales or forged documents.
  • Efficiency – Faster transfers, reduced paperwork, and instant verification.

For example, India has piloted blockchain-based land registry systems in states like Andhra Pradesh and Telangana, ensuring property records remain secure and transparent. Similarly, Sweden’s land authority tested blockchain for faster and more reliable property transfers.

Challenges and Policy Considerations

While promising, blockchain for identity and land records faces adoption hurdles:

  • Technical integration with legacy systems.
  • Legal frameworks for blockchain-based records.
  • Data privacy concerns in decentralized storage.
  • High implementation costs for large-scale rollouts.

Governments must balance trust and security with blockchain while ensuring compliance with laws. Collaboration between public institutions, blockchain experts, and policymakers is critical for success.

Case Studies: Global Leaders in Blockchain Public Records

  • Estonia – A pioneer in digital identity, Estonia uses blockchain-inspired architecture for e-services, elections, and healthcare.
  • India – Pilots for blockchain-based land registries aim to cut corruption and speed up property transfers.
  • Georgia – Partnered with Bitfury to secure land registry data using blockchain.
  • Sweden – Tested blockchain in property transfers, proving faster and more reliable outcomes.

These initiatives highlight how blockchain for government services enhances trust and efficiency.
